The overview below groups typical Decorative Gravel Delivery proj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or decorative gravel repairs or touch-ups generally range from $100 to $300. Many routine jobs fall within this lower band, depending on the size and scope of the project.
Standard Delivery - For the delivery of decorative gravel for medium-sized projects, local contractors often charge between $250 and $600. This range covers most residential installations and smaller landscaping jobs.
Large Installations - Larger, more complex projects such as extensive pathways or garden beds can cost between $1,000 and $3,000.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, which typically involves more material and labor.
Full Replacement or Commercial Jobs - Full-scale replacements or commercial-scale deliveries can exceed $5,000, with costs varying based on volume and site conditions. These projects are less common and tend to fall into the higher end of typical ranges.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of decorative gravel are available for delivery? Local contractors typically offer a variety of decorative gravel options, including river rock, crushed stone, pea gravel, and other aggregates suited for landscaping and decorative purposes.
How can I determine the right type of gravel for my project? Service providers can help assess your needs and recommend suitable gravel types based on your landscape design and functional requirements.
Is decorative gravel delivery suitable for large or small projects? Yes, local contractors can handle deliveries for both small residential gardens and larger commercial landscaping projects.
What are some common uses for decorative gravel in landscaping? Decorative gravel is often used for pathways, garden beds, accent areas, drainage solutions, and decorative borders.
